I thought about getting the 8mm but I didn't know if it was too big to fit in the coils.
 
The stock wire size is solid core 7mm wire. You can trim the ends of your wires if you wanna go the cheap route, you can get slightly more expensive (less than 10 bucks)and buy standard copper core wire by the foot (the route i went and was very happy with), got mine from

Or you can go the expensive route and pay for the aftermarket wires and boots which i dont think do anything other than give you more eye candy to look at.

my recent experience with this when i changed over to Dyna 3000 TCI box and Dynatek coils is this;

If you replace the wires with another solid core wire you MUST use the factory resistance boots.

If you replace the wires with a suppresion wire you can use the factory boots or any aftermarket non-resistance boot.

Some type of suppresion is required or it will throw interference into the TCI box and act like an intermittent "Miss"

Sometimes the aftermarket boots look better which is why I went with them along with suppresion wires.

If you go with aftermarket boots it is a good idea to re-use the rubber collar that fits down low on the factory boot to keep trash out of the hole around the sparkplug or the trash will end up in the cylinder when you pull the plugs.
